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 22.10.2009, 14:38
Alex100
 
Сообщений: n/a

Не обновляется ДОМ документ
есть таблица, в которую добовляются новые элементы при нажатии на ссылку
но почему то, при обращении к подгруженным элементам ничего не происходит

например r новому id $("#del_tn")
или любой новой ссылке

<table border=1 id="conest_tn">
<tr><th>Тариф</th><th>Номер</th><th>Стоимость</th><th>Удалить</th></tr>

</table>


<div id="add_tn"><a href="#">Добавить номер</a></div>

<div id="load_num"></div>
</td></tr></table>
</div>



$(document).ready(
    function() {

var d = 1;

$("#get_num").click(function () {

pwd = $("#abs select option:selected").val();
$("p").text(pwd);
$("#load_num").load("select_num.php",{tarif: pwd});

});



$("#add_tn a").click(function () {


add_str = '<tr id="f' + d + '"><td id="abs"><select nane="z_tarif[]"><option value="1">123</option><option value="8">345</option></select></td><td id="get_num" nowrap><a href="#">Выбрать </a><p></p></td><td id="get_sum"></td><td id="del_tn"><a href="#"><img src="/a/img/b_drop.png" border=0></a></td></tr>';

$("#conest_tn").append(add_str);
$("#del_tn").hide();
});


$("#del_tn a").click(function () {

s = $(this).parent().parent().attr("id");
alert($("td").text());
});


});
Ответить с цитированием
  #2 (permalink)  
Старый 23.10.2009, 02:46
Аватар для x-yuri
Отправить личное сообщение для x-yuri Посмотреть профиль Найти все сообщения от x-yuri
 
Регистрация: 27.12.2008
Сообщений: 4,201

live

Сообщение от Alex100
ДОМ документ
это не имеет смысла, DOM - это интерфейс для работы с html/xml-документами
Ответить с цитированием
  #3 (permalink)  
Старый 23.10.2009, 14:51
Alex100
 
Сообщений: n/a

да, как выяснилось, проблема в некорректной работе append()
в опере и firefox

а в эксплореле все ок
Ответить с цитированием
  #4 (permalink)  
Старый 23.10.2009, 14:59
Аватар для x-yuri
Отправить личное сообщение для x-yuri Посмотреть профиль Найти все сообщения от x-yuri
 
Регистрация: 27.12.2008
Сообщений: 4,201

Сообщение от Alex100
да, как выяснилось, проблема в некорректной работе append()
в опере и firefox
и в чем же некорректная работа append заключается? Только внятнее, а не как в прошлый раз, потому что под "подгруженными" элементами я понял те, которые с помощью load загружаются
Ответить с цитированием
  #5 (permalink)  
Старый 26.10.2009, 12:03
Alex100
 
Сообщений: n/a

add_str = '<tr id="f' + d + '"><td id="abs"><select nane="z_tarif[]"><option value="1">123</option><option value="8">345</option></select></td><td id="get_num" nowrap><a href="#">Выбрать </a><p></p></td><td id="get_sum"></td><td id="del_tn"><a href="#"><img src="/a/img/b_drop.png" border=0></a></td></tr>';
 
$("#conest_tn").append(add_str);


вот этим кодом загружаются дополнительные поля формы
<select nane="z_tarif[]">...</select>
и потом добавляется <input type="hidden" name="z_nomer[]" value="*">

так вот, после добавления этих полей, нажимаем submit формы
и php скрипту должны передаться переменные z_tarif[] и z_nomer[]

в эксплореле все без проблем передается, а в фаерфоксе и опере не передаются

уже не знаю что делать, проблему досих пор не решил
Ответить с цитированием
  #6 (permalink)  
Старый 26.10.2009, 14:58
Аватар для x-yuri
Отправить личное сообщение для x-yuri Посмотреть профиль Найти все сообщения от x-yuri
 
Регистрация: 27.12.2008
Сообщений: 4,201

у меня все работает
Ответить с цитированием
  #7 (permalink)  
Старый 26.10.2009, 16:09
Alex100
 
Сообщений: n/a

у вас firefox 3.5.3
jquery 1.3.1
?
Ответить с цитированием
  #8 (permalink)  
Старый 26.10.2009, 17:09
Аватар для x-yuri
Отправить личное сообщение для x-yuri Посмотреть профиль Найти все сообщения от x-yuri
 
Регистрация: 27.12.2008
Сообщений: 4,201

да, дай ссылку на страницу
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
document.write - как дописать документ SunYang Общие вопросы Javascript 18 16.12.2013 15:43
Как удалить из памяти весь XML документ? EisBerg Events/DOM/Window 1 03.04.2010 14:45
Добавление строк в текущий документ deerstop Общие вопросы Javascript 11 24.09.2009 23:17
Подскажите, пжлст, как вывести в тот же документ результат ф-ции? LexXxeL Элементы интерфейса 4 13.05.2009 13:26
как открыть документ частично? mirniy Общие вопросы Javascript 3 02.03.2009 18:37